  • Patent number: 5453498
    Abstract: The invention relates to a method of producing a high-monoester sucrose higher fatty acid ester with a monoester content of at least 90%. In accordance with this invention, a sucrose higher fatty acid ester which is actually a mixture of the corresponding monoester, diester, triester, etc. is dissolved in 1 to 12 parts by weight of a solvent having a specific inductive capacity, at 25.degree. C., of 30 to 50 at an elevated temperature, the precipitate formed on subsequent cooling is removed to recover a supernatant and the solvent is removed from the supernatant. In accordance with the invention, a high-monoester sucrose higher fatty acid ester can be produced easily and with good reproducibility.

  • Patent number: 4898935
    Abstract: This invention relates to a method of producing sucrose fatty acid ester granules by the fluidized bed granulation and drying technique and consists in forming a fluidized bed comprising a sucrose fatty acid ester powder at a temperature not exceeding 60.degree. C., spraying the fluidized bed with an aqueous sucrose fatty acid ester solution having a concentration of 3-20% by weight, as a binder, and then drying the sprayed fluidized bed, to thereby cause granulation. In accordance with the invention, the disintegration of sucrose fatty acid ester granules during granulation and drying can be prevented and highly pure sucrose fatty acid ester granules can be obtained. The sucrose fatty acid ester granules produced by the method of the invention are incapable of forming a cloud of fine powder, and have very good dispersibility and solubility.

  • Patent number: 4441691
    Abstract: A hoisting winch for cranes or the like having a power transmission system assembled in a final reduction drive of the winch and arranged such that arresting of the whole planetary gear set meshing with a ring gear connected to a spooling drum and releasing of the arrest can be effected by arresting a carrier and by releasing the arrest and that a rotary drive power from an input shaft is transmitted to the spooling drum when the carrier is held against rotation, brake means adapted to be spring applied and hydraulically released with its control circuit to arrest or release the carrier, and an adjustable pressure reducing valve provided in the control circuit for adjusting and controlling a braking force of the brake means.
